Hanoi ordered Repsol to leave the area and Block 136-03 after Beijing said it would attack Vietnam military bases in Spratly Islands if drilling continued. Source: Getty Images

A Spanish energy company has stopped all ongoing work on a planned offshore natural gas project in waters disputed between Vietnam and China in the South China Sea after a request to do so by Vietnamese state oil firm PetroVietnam.
